My first school was in Wharf Street, Stoke. It was in a poor state even for the low base of Stoke Primary schools in the 1960s. The school was strongly associated with St Peter’s Church and had been founded in 1812. It was run down and dilapidated. An early memory is the nursery sand pit which suffered from an invasion by cockroaches. |

A pensioner who garnered international headlines when he fought off raiders in a bookies shop in Cork city has been laid to rest today. Mourners who engaged in social distancing lined the route as the hearse containing the remains of Denis O’Connor passed his son's pub to go to his native Kiskeam for his funeral. |
